She has been writing some books under the pseudonym Barbara Vine. She lives in London and is known English crime writer. Known for her psycological thrillers and murder mysteries. Has worked as a journalist for Essex newspapers. Novel ,,Master of the Moor" was Publisher 1982. She has been rewarded with Silver, Gold and Cartier Diamond Daggers awards from Crime Writers' Assosiation and many other awards. Setting The action takes place in the city of Vangmoor. Lots of action goes around the Moor. Time of the story unknown. Characters Stephen Whalby ­ ''Voice of Vangmoor", Loves walks on the Moor. Suspected of killing girls because he knows Moor very well. Not very into the marriage. Lyn Whalby ­ Stephens wife. Leaves Stephen because of Nick. Dadda Whalby ­ Stephens father. Owns a shop and loves antiques. Peter Naulls ­ Stephens old friend and playfriend when he was litte. Loves to travel and Works in London. Nick ­ Stephens old schoolfriend. Lyns new boyfriend.
